Typical Home Vermin
Although home bugs can differ dramatically in type and habits, numerous share typical characteristics that make them a problem. Typical family bugs include rodents such as rats and computer mice, bugs like cockroaches and ants, and occasional invaders such as spiders and flies. These bugs usually thrive in environments that give very easy access to food, water, and shelter, making homes particularly vulnerable.
Rodents, for circumstances, are well-known for causing architectural damages and spreading disease. They can chomp through electric cables, potentially resulting in fire risks. Insects like roaches are not only disturbing but can likewise set off allergies and asthma in delicate individuals. Ants, while usually harmless, can invade kitchen areas, rendering food resources unappealing.
Efficient parasite management begins with prevention, which consists of sealing entry factors, keeping cleanliness, and using suitable storage space techniques for food. Yard Parasites and Their Impact
Yard parasites posture a considerable risk to the health and performance of plants, with some quotes recommending that they can cause up to 40% of plant losses in particular regions. These pests, which include bugs such as aphids, caterpillars, and beetles, as well as nematodes, can bring upon serious damage by feeding upon plant tissues, causing stunted growth, lowered yields, and endangered top quality.
The impact of garden pests expands beyond simple aesthetic concerns; they can disrupt ecosystems by altering food web, impacting pollinators, and spreading conditions amongst plants. As an example, pests like the spider mite can compromise plants, making them much more at risk to fungal infections. Moreover, invasive types may outcompete indigenous plants, causing biodiversity loss.
Integrated Bug Management (IPM) methods, which integrate biological control, social practices, and targeted chemical applications, can give sustainable services. Reliable Treatment Techniques
When handling rodent infestations, utilizing effective therapy methods is vital for decreasing damage and health risks. A multi-faceted approach commonly yields the finest results. Catches are an essential part of rodent control. Break traps and electronic traps offer a gentle and fast way to get rid of rodents, while adhesive catches can help keep track of activity degrees.
Secondly, bait stations containing rodenticides can be tactically placed in areas of high rodent activity. These stations must be tamper-resistant to guarantee the safety of non-target pets and youngsters. It is critical to select the suitable lure type, as rats can develop lure hostility otherwise transformed periodically.
In enhancement to traps and lure, securing access points can significantly decrease the possibilities of re-infestation. This includes inspecting and fixing spaces in doors, home windows, and wall surfaces.
